Plastic Tube Packaging Market Size
The global plastic tube packaging market was valued at USD 6.1 billion in 2024 and is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 3.7% from 2025 to 2034. Investment in advanced capabilities enables companies to improve production technologies, thus fueling the growth of tube plastic packaging markets, maintaining customization levels, and maintaining high demand for sustainable solutions to high-performance packaging problems. These advances enable plastic tube packaging manufacturers to develop a wider range of products for cosmetics, pharmaceuticals, personal care, and other industries, allowing the market to grow.
In May 2024, Neopac expanded its operations in Wilson, NC, and launched a new line of tubes for cosmetics which increased production by 70 million units per year. The investment enhances plastic tube packaging capabilities including colorations and printing. Neopac also launched Polyfoil Sensation, the first recycling-ready barrier tube that supports its sustainable packaging initiatives.
Plastic Tube Packaging Market Trends
The invention of new materials with enhanced barrier properties as well as advanced fabrics is one of the most significant developments in the market. Companies are now concentrating on producing multi-layered laminates with advanced pigments and crystallized layers. These changes promote the increased functionality, longevity, and recyclability of plastic tube packaging for different sensitive industries, such as cosmetics and pharmaceuticals. Such factors increase demand for green and performance packaging solutions.
For instance, Advanced Plastic Laminate and Methods of Manufacturing is the patent granted to Huhtamaki in April 2024 on innovative plastic barrier laminates containing crystallized polyethylene layers and pigmented layers containing semitransparent pigments. This material offers excellent packaging flexibility and is especially beneficial for flexible tube containers because of its enhanced barrier properties. The laminate is engineered with specific pigment weights and crystallization levels, allowing for more efficient processing of various functions across a wide range of applications.
Plastic Tube Packaging Market Analysis
Environmental issues and regulations are serious obstacles in the packaging of plastic tubes. Due to increasing concerns about plastic waste pollution, global laws are becoming more stringent and require long-term sustainable solutions from companies. These solutions include reducing plastic use, increasing plastic recycling, and developing other materials. To meet these requirements, research and development activities for environmentally friendly products such as biodegradable and recyclable packaging have increased, and operating costs have increased. Furthermore, compliance with the global sustainable development objectives has added restrictions to the supply chain and requires a movement towards low-impact alternatives that do not harm packaging functions.
The plastic tube packaging industries have an opportunity to develop environmentally friendly and recyclable packaging solutions. Packaging companies face market opportunities, right from environmentally friendly packaging tubes made of bioplastics to tubes made from recycled materials. This is because manufacturers and other stakeholders are now more concerned about social responsibility.
Based on material, the plastic tube packaging market is divided into polyethylene (PE), polypropylene (PP), polyethylene terephthalate (PET), polyvinyl chloride (PVC), and others. The polyethylene (PE) segment is expected to reach a value of over USD 3 billion by 2034.
Based on tube type, the plastic tube packaging market is divided into squeeze & collapsible, and twist. The squeeze and collapsible segment is the fastest growing segment with a CAGR of over 4% between 2025 and 2034.
North America held the share of over 25% in 2024. The main reason for the enormous growth of the plastic tube packaging market in the United States is its established manufacturing base and technological capabilities. The American market has begun to use more sophisticated packaging, such as squeezable and collapsible tubes. This reflects the demand for environmentally friendly packaging for the consumer. Furthermore, the population of the United States is both large and diversified, which also gives more commercial avenues to other businesses such as cosmetics, personal care, and pharmaceuticals, wherein plastic tube packaging is widely in use.
China's growing demand for plastic tube packaging is supported by the rapid growth of the manufacturing industry and the development of the middle class. Furthermore, the support provided by the Chinese Government for manufacturing innovation significantly strengthens market growth prospects.
The Indian plastic tube packaging market is expected to grow due to the growth of consumer goods markets, especially in the cosmetics, food, and health industries. Increased urbanization and higher disposable incomes are driving the demand for improved packaging products and affordable solutions to meet various packaging needs. The popularity of plastic tubes is on the rise due to their cost-effectiveness and convenience.
South Korea's market is growing steadily, driven by increasing demand for cosmetics, personal care and tube pharmaceutical products. The country has advanced technological infrastructure to manufacture various packaging options that can satisfy even the most advanced consumers. In addition, South Korea's effective plastic regulations encourage the industry to incorporate green materials and increase recycling levels in processes that increase market growth for plastic tube packaging.
In Japan, plastic tube packaging markets continue to flourish, owing to the country's preparations in consumer goods sectors such as cosmetics, drugs, and food. Japanese culture validates the idea that consumers pay great attention to high-standard package designs. This subsequently led to an increase in the purchase of practical, durable, and aesthetic plastic tubes. In Japan, there is also an incentive to produce eco-friendly packaging products, such as recyclable and biodegradable tubes and containers. These factors, combined with growing consumer demand, are helping to grow Japan's market.
